Green Meadows, OH vs Jackson, OH
Green Meadows, OH and Jackson, OH have a very similar cost of living, with only a 3% difference in their overall index. Green Meadows scores 68 while Jackson scores 66 on the cost of living index, where 100 represents the national average. The day-to-day expenses for residents in both cities are comparable, though differences emerge when looking at specific categories.
On the housing front, median rent in Green Meadows is $851/month compared to $784/month in Jackson — a 9%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Jackson is more affordable at $128,300 median vs $140,900.
Median household income in Green Meadows is $65,179 compared to $53,609 in Jackson (+21.6%). While Green Meadows is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Green Meadows spend roughly 15.7% of their income on rent, less than the 17.5% in Jackson.
Climate-wise, both cities share similar average temperatures (53.9°F vs 56.5°F). Jackson receives more rainfall at 45.1" per year compared to 41.3" in Green Meadows.
